Optimization or weighted libraries to effective sections through use of sensitivity coefficients

Description

Weighted libraries are the most widespread form of compiling pre-generated cross sections. During the calculation of core diffusion code cross sections obtained by interpolation of the values in the grid points. As interpolation errors depend on the distance between those points, it requires considerable refinement of the mesh to achieve adequate accuracy, leading to high storage requirements. To avoid this problem, we have developed an optimization procedure Weighted library for selecting the minimum number of grid points for each independent state variable, maintaining a factual error in the multiplication constant k-effective.
